Connection, on rear, top 4p
Optional accessories for the circuit-breaker series NZM offers a comprehensive portfolio of application options for use world wide. The mounting is always flexible and easy thanks to the modular function groups. Notes: part no. suffix and part no. contain parts for a circuit-breaker side at top or bottom for 3 or 4 pole circuit-breakers. O = for fitting at the top. U = for fitting at the bottom. Can be used for: NZM2(-4), PN2(-4), N2(-4)
